Here at High Gear Media, we've talked a lot about the stunning Porsche 918 spyder. Most recently, we learned that it's officially making the leap from concept to production, and it's going to be more powerful than expected. Yesterday, we saw Jay Leno and Arnold Schwarzenegger smitten by the supercar's steering wheel (well, sort of), and today, we've stumbled across an in-depth video tour of the 918, brought to us by none other than Leno himself.

Leno isn't just a car guy, and he isn't just an entertainer: thanks to his highly popular website, Jay Leno's Garage, he's also a social media phenomenon. So, it was only natural that when Porsche brought the 918 out to play at the Pebble Beach Concours d'Elegance, the automaker carved out some time for Leno to meet the car's chief designer, Michael Mauer.


Here's a clip of that rendez-vous, with a fairly thorough rundown of the 918's capabilities. (And since the 918 is a hybrid, with a big battery pack and a luscious V8 engine, those capabilities are pretty impressive.) Thrown in among all the chatter about horsepower and miles-per-gallon, there's an interesting moment about two minutes in (6:30 left on the clock), when Leno disses electric rides that "cost more than a gas car, they go 50 or 60 miles". Is that a dig at Nissan? MINI? And how, exactly, does Leno feel about the 918's  $630,000 price tag, which is a good 20 times the cost of "a gas car"? We suppose those questions will have to wait.
